UIC attends the International Transport Forum Consultation meetings

Share this article

On 30-31 January 2024, UIC Director General François Davenne, together with Philippe Lorand, UIC Director of Institutional Relations and Asia-Pacific Coordinator, and Joo Hyun Ha, UIC Sustainability Strategy & International Partnerships Senior Advisor, attended the 2024 International Transport Forum (ITF) Consultation meetings on Gender, ITF Research programmes, and the ITF Summit 2024-2025.

These events brought together international organisations to provide input and serve as a forum to exchange ideas on the 2024 ITF Summit “Greening Transport: Keeping Focus in Times of Crises”. UIC presented key activities on gender equality, through the Train 2B Equal project, as well as key advocacy activities on Nationally Determined Contributions (NDCs) and climate finance, including the study on “Bridging the Rail Finance Gap: challenges and opportunities for LMICs” launched at COP28 in December 2023.

Davenne highlighted the need for a paradigm shift, driven by an increased transport share for active mobility and public transport to advance the sector’s decarbonisation, as well as how climate finance can be used to fund such a modal shift. CER, ERA and EU-RAIL were also at the meeting, showing a great breadth of representation from the rail sector.
